The opportunity

We’re se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Senior Analyst to support the resolution of external disputes raised by clients, members, regulators, and stakeholders.

The Operational Governance Division comprises of Distribution Governance & a variety of Governance related roles, including transaction monitoring and fraud.

This role is critical in maintaining Netwealths reputation and fostering trust with AFCA, clients, and stakeholders.

Key responsibilities

  • Investigate and respond to external complaints in line with RG 271 and other regulatory requirements

  • Liaise with external agencies including AFCA to ensure timely and accurate resolution

  • Document dispute processes and outcomes with precision

  • Recommend solutions that align with legal obligations and internal policies

  • Managing high volumes of complex disputes within strict regulatory timeframes

  • Ensure consistency and fairness in dispute outcomes while tailoring responses to individual cases

  • Keeping up with regulatory changes and industry best practices

  • Meet SLA related to resolution time, customer satisfaction, and compliance

About you

  • 1–3 years experience in dispute resolution, compliance, or legal roles

  • Strong knowledge of RG 271 and AFCA processes

  • Tertiary qualifications in Law, Business, or related fields

  • Familiarity with governance and risk systems such as Protecht and CRM platforms

  • Excellent communication and documentation skills

  • Be able to stay informed on regulatory changes and adapt to evolving industry standards

  • Commit to ongoing learning and engage in professional development to maintain expertise in compliance and dispute handling
